The word is out! Savvy travellers all over the world are quietly discovering the best kept secret of the South Pacific, the Cook Islands. TripAdvisor, the world's largest travel review website, has compiled a list from traveller's reviews of the Top 10 most Breathtaking Beaches for Fun and Surf, ranking Aitutaki Lagoon and Muri Lagoon in the Top Five.
Recognised as one of the world's largest interactive travel sites, TripAdvisor has compiled the list from real reviews from travellers around the world, who give impartial feedback and opinions through the website.
Aitutaki Lagoon, situated on the island of Aitutaki, is made up of 20 small, uninhabited islands dotted around the turquoise lagoon, offering the perfect place for an idyllic getaway and bountiful spots for snorkelling, swimming and kitesurfing. Two of these islands, the exquisite Moturaku and Rapota, are also the setting of soon-to-return UK reality TV programme Shipwrecked, where the two teams of Tigers and Sharks will battle it out in the experience of a life time.
Muri Lagoon, on the south-eastern coast of the capital island Rarotonga, is a kilometre-long golden arc of white sand backed by tall palm and ironwood trees. Muri Beach also faces four uninhabited islands and the shallow lagoon allows swimmers to paddle out to these islets at low tide.
